A Dance of Words and Images Through Time

The rich history of Word Pictures Art spans centuries, from the hieroglyphics of antiquity to contemporary digital creations. Artists have historically leveraged text to add nuanced meaning to their works or to steer interpretation. These textual visual arts have evolved, reflecting cultural dialogues and personal introspections melded with aesthetic appeal.

The Modern Tapestry of Textual Visual Arts

The advent of modernist and postmodernist movements marked a transformative period for Word Pictures Art, bringing forth innovation and creative exploration. Notable figures like Rene Magritte disrupted conventional thinking, while pop art phenomenon Andy Warhol used text to comment on consumerism. Today, this genre remains vibrant, embracing technological advances to further intricate visual-textual conversations.

Contemporary Mastery of Words and Images

In today’s art scene, diverse techniques are employed to fuse language with imagery, ranging from traditional calligraphy to state-of-the-art digital methods. Artists choose various styles, each selecting fonts, colors, and arrangements to maximize the intended impact of their pieces, demonstrating the limitless possibilities within the realm of Word Pictures Art.

The simultaneous engagement of vision and language processing inherent in Word Pictures Art offers a psychologically impactful and intellectually challenging experience. Viewers often find themselves deciphering and interpreting, an exercise that not only engages but deepens the collective understanding of art’s communicative power.

Text Art in the Digital Era

The integration of digital tools has opened new horizons for Word Pictures Art, enabling complex designs and broader audience engagement through platforms like social media. Immersive virtual environments have also emerged, offering three-dimensional experiences where text and imagery coalesce seamlessly.

Commercial and Educational Resonance of Textual Imagery

Moving beyond aesthetic realms, the commercial sector has adopted Word Pictures Art for its efficacy in branding and advertising. Furthermore, this art form serves educational and therapeutic roles, supporting literacy and serving as a means for emotive articulation through art therapy practices.
